Who we are

Our website address is: https://onetexaspodcast.com. The purpose of this platform is to amplify the voices of real people by sharing their lived experiences, ensuring that this platform reflects authentic stories rather than just the ideas of its contributors.

All contributions to this website are inevitably shaped by our individual life experiences. In the spirit of full disclosure, allow me to introduce myself: my name is Maria Luisa Alvarado. I developed the theme for this platform based on my own experiences as a political campaign manager and candidate in Texas.

After the votes are counted and the results announced, the voices that filled the campaign trail often muted—overshadowed by the noise of who won, who lost, and why. Whether or not I ever take part in another campaign, this platform is a space to preserve and amplify those voices beyond election day. If you are a former or current political candidate, you are especially invited to be a contributor.
